The occupancy feed for the Larkspur Garage network is served by the stallwatch service at five-minute intervals. Each response contains per-level counts, sensor health flags, and a staleness timestamp; consumers should discard readings older than fifteen minutes. Requests must include the internal service key in the X-Stallwatch-Auth header, and unauthenticated calls return 401 without a body. For local development and the shared staging environment, maintainers use the following key.

app token of kajeg-hafop = kto7_tzVv3xY

**Mgmt Meeting Minutes — Retiring the Brightline Range**

Quick recap for sales leads at Fenholt Supplies: we agreed to retire the Brightline fixture range by year-end. Remaining stock moves to clearance pricing next month, and accounts on standing orders get migrated to the Lumetta range. Trade-in incentives were approved in principle. The confidential note on next steps sits just below.

board note of bajof-bajeg: The pricing group signed off on a budget of $13.4 million for Project Sildor. The renewal with Lamixek Holdings closes at $48.9 million a year, 49 percent above the last contract.

## Runbook: Flaky integration tests — Paylark service

Welcome aboard! If the Paylark integration suite fails intermittently, don't panic — it's usually the sandbox settlement mock timing out, not your change. First, rerun just the failing suite. If it fails twice in a row, check whether the mock container restarted mid-run. Still red? Ping the payments channel before retrying a third time. When you escalate, include the token from the failing run, shown below.

pipeline stamp: htk9_ce63042d9

**What do I do if I lose my badge on a night shift?** Report it to the duty supervisor at Marrowgate Depot immediately so the badge can be deactivated before morning. Do not borrow a colleague's badge or prop doors open. A temporary pass can be issued from the control room; log the issue time in the shift book. Until the temporary pass is ready, use the night entrance code below.

turnstile pass: bdg-FVNQRS-72965873